    They didn’t divvy up packs for the store. They had a separate team that was exclusively making store content. All of it was 100% separate from the main development team, and even when the same studio got an EP development team it was entirely separate from the store.

    Was the store expensive? Yes, and that is a valid criticism against it, but they didn’t withhold EP content to sell in the store.
